Job Description
- Develop and/or analyze quantitative models that assess the market credit and/or operational risks of new and existing financial and mortgage products or portfolios to support business and risk decisions.
- Develop strategies to analyze and interpret output of models or analytic applications which assess things such as default losses and required capital of the portfolio.
- Plan execute and document analysis of complex financial models and provide support to the use of model applications.
- May provide portfolio risk assessments based on findings. May provide modeling and analytical assistance to a line of business or product area functioning as day-to-day technical expert.
- Evaluate and manage risks associated with the companys models including models of defaults security valuation prepayments loan scoring and others.
- May perform detailed model validation reviews establishing performance thresholds researching model approaches creating alternative models and other means.
- Provide innovative thorough and practical solutions to an extensive range of demanding problems including analyses of relative value.
